addFoundSet |
|
void addFoundSet (fs) | |
Exposes an unrelated foundset to the mobile client. If service solution has a module of type Mobile shared module all possible relations from that module are traversed automatically.
|
|
Parameters {JSFoundSet} fs - the foundset
|
|
Returns void
|
|
Sample var retval = plugins.mobileservice.createOfflineDataDescription('data_'); var ff = databaseManager.getFoundSet('bug_db','mytable'); ff.loadAllRecords(); retval.addFoundSet(ff); |

addFoundSet |
|
void addFoundSet (fs, relationNamesToTraverse) | |
Exposes an unrelated foundset to the mobile client.
which can be used in the mobile client in an unrelated way like in a (first) form or databaseManager.getFoundset(...) for each record in the provided (unrelated) foundset the specified relation names are traversed and all data taken. |
|
Parameters {JSFoundSet} fs - the root foundset
{String[]} relationNamesToTraverse - the relations to traverse from records found in root root foundset |
|
Returns void
|
|
Sample var data = plugins.mobileservice.createOfflineDataDescription('data_'); var fs_contact = globals.accountmanager_contacts; //contains the account manager contact var traverse = new Array(); traverse.push('accountmanager_to_companies'); data.addFoundSet(fs_contact, traverse); |
